Job description

Copello are supporting a leading aerospace and defence manufacturer in the recruitment of a Production Scheduler to join their growing team.

Operating from a highly advanced manufacturing facility, the organisation specialises in the design, production, and testing of complex systems for the aerospace sector. With significant investment in its people, technology, and capabilities, this is an exciting opportunity to join a business at the forefront of innovation and operational excellence.

Key Job Activities
  • Create and manage detailed short-term production schedules, ensuring alignment with customer priorities, material availability, and the wider production plan.
  • Release and sequence work orders to maximise production efficiency and minimise disruption when constraints arise.
  • Monitor work-in-progress and production performance, proactively identifying bottlenecks, risks, and overdue orders, implementing recovery plans where required.
  • Collaborate with Operations, Supply Chain, Stores, Procurement, and Quality teams to resolve material shortages and support the smooth execution of the production schedule.
  • Track schedule adherence and production performance, providing regular updates on risks, deviations, and corrective actions to key stakeholders.
  • Support production planning and operational review meetings, ensuring clear communication of priorities and delivery commitments.
  • Maintain accurate planning data within ERP systems, ensuring production parameters, lead times, and master data reflect operational capability.
  • Drive continuous improvement in scheduling processes, data accuracy, and production execution to support on-time delivery and operational performance.
Qualifications & Experience
  • Experience in production control, scheduling, or shop floor coordination.
  • Strong understanding of ERP/MRP systems and production workflows.
  • Ability to manage constraints, adjust schedules rapidly, and collaborate across functions.
  • Analytical mindset with strong attention to detail and data accuracy.

Please note: Please note BPSS Clearance must be obtainable for this role
